Riding The Vinyl Boom, Technics Returns With New Turntable

Source:
HypeBot
The vinyl record boom has been good for artists and great for independent records stores. But it has also spawned startups to serve vinyl lovers and a resurgence in turntable manufacturing. Technics, once one of the leading names in turntables, announced that they are re-entering the turntable market. Technics parent Panasonic showed off a prototype of the new deck (pictured above) at the IFA Trade Show in Berlin. The new analog direct drive turntable is made from aluminum and at ...

The Outdoor Music Festival Boom

Source:
HypeBot
Are music festivals too popular for their own good? While the recorded music industry remains tumultuous, the popularity of outdoor music festivals only continues to grow, to the point where finding enough big name artists to act as headliners has become a challenge. Live Streaming Boosts Music Festival Boom

Source:
HypeBot
American music festivals are in a strong growth phase and that includes free live streaming broadcasts of festival performances. With festivals selling out there's a larger audience interested in checking in on favorite acts or special events. As these audiences grow the potential for advertising revenue from live streaming grows as well. 2012 has been a great year for American music festivals both large and small. Another Study Predicts Cloud Music to Boom

Source:
HypeBot
Earlier this month, ABI Research predicted that cloud music to boom in the next five years, reaching a subscriber of 161 million by 2016. They believed that smartphone penetration, a lowering in price, and an emerging Asia-Pacific market would give services like Spotify and Rhapsody a boost.
